There is a soundboard tape of them and others from the 1969 Seattle Pop Festival in Woodinville WA, but it's still in the hands of an eccentric Japanese collector last I heard. 
They apparently stole the show at that festival, and blew The Doors literally right off the stage. I remember reading that a local LZ collector in Seattle pissed off the sound guy that kept the tape in negotiations so instead he sold it to a Byrds collector for 10K who then traded it for rare Byrds stuff from the Japanese guy. A real shame, but maybe someday it will surface. I highly doubt the Byrds collector didn't make a copy.
